Background
Mbala General Hospital is a busy healthcare facility located in the Northern Province of Zambia, a country with a population of over 18 million people. The hospital provides a range of medical services, including emergency care, surgery, and Maternal and Child Health (MCH) services, to a catchment area of over 200,000 people. Prior to the introduction of the waste incinerators, the hospital faced significant challenges in managing its medical waste, including inadequate storage facilities, lack of trained personnel, and limited resources for waste disposal. The hospital’s medical waste was often disposed of in an open pit, which posed significant risks to public health and the environment.
The Waste Incinerators
In 2018, Mbala General Hospital installed two waste incinerators, which were funded by the Zambian government and international donors. The incinerators were designed to handle the hospital’s medical waste, including infectious waste, sharps, and non-infectious waste. The incinerators use a combination of thermal and chemical processes to break down the waste, reducing its volume by up to 90%. The resulting ash is then disposed of in a secure landfill.
The waste incinerators have several key features that make them an effective solution for medical waste management:
- High-temperature incineration: The incinerators operate at temperatures of up to 1200°C, which is sufficient to destroy even the most resistant pathogens.
- Air pollution control: The incinerators are equipped with scrubbers and filters, which reduce particulate matter and gaseous emissions to acceptable levels.
- Ash handling: The resulting ash is collected in a secure container and transported to a landfill for disposal.
- Training and capacity building: Hospital staff received training on the safe operation and maintenance of the incinerators, as well as on waste segregation and handling practices.
Benefits
The introduction of the waste incinerators at Mbala General Hospital has had several benefits, including:
- Improved public health: The incinerators have reduced the risk of disease transmission and environmental pollution, protecting public health and the environment.
- Increased efficiency: The incinerators have streamlined the hospital’s waste management processes, reducing the need for manual sorting and disposal.
- Cost savings: The incinerators have reduced the hospital’s waste disposal costs, which were previously high due to the need for transportation to a distant landfill.
- Enhanced environmental protection: The incinerators have reduced the hospital’s environmental impact, minimizing the release of greenhouse gases and other pollutants.
